About the book

In «Lydia of the Pines,» Honoré Morrow explores the intricate interplay of identity, nature, and community through the lens of a young woman's tumultuous journey. Set against the backdrop of a fictional but richly depicted landscape, Morrow employs evocative prose and vivid imagery, marrying lyrical descriptions with a profound psychological depth. The narrative unfolds in a time when societal norms exerted significant pressure on personal choices, reflecting the broader cultural currents of 19th-century America, particularly the tension between individualism and social expectation. As Lydia grapples with her internal conflicts, her story resonates with universal themes of self-discovery and resilience, making it a distinctive addition to American literary canon. Honoré Morrow, an author well-versed in the complexities of human emotion, infuses her characters with authenticity derived from her own lived experiences. A keen observer of the societal dynamics of her time, Morrow's background and personal struggles undoubtedly shaped her desire to portray a strong, relatable female protagonist. Her unique perspective on women's roles and societal expectations lends Lydia a depth that reflects both personal and collective challenges. Readers seeking an introspective and richly textured narrative will find «Lydia of the Pines» both compelling and enlightening. Morrow invites audiences to join Lydia on her transformative journey, offering insights not only into the historical context of her time but also into the enduring nature of personal growth and the search for one's place in the world. This novel is a must-read for those interested in the exploration of identity and gender within an evocatively rendered landscape.
